12 Feb 2024 18:46 #49157 by Valence
OK, I've turned the wings into a higher poly mesh (using the sculpting soften tool with Dyntopo rather than the voxel remesh that didn't work well at all) and I've now Booleaned (that's not a real word. :nope:) them together with the dragon body so that they don't come apart when you try to rig them.
I'm now glad I tried that rigging experiment first. I would be very annoyed if I discovered that problem right at the end :)
He still doesn't have teefies yet but I think the next thing to do is vertex painting to make it look ...erm... dragony? Lifelike? Or maybe just... better? :unsure:
At the moment, despite all the effort, it doesn't look any different from the last wip so there's no point in posting another one. :shrug:
